Huawei P40 Pro Review - Smartphone with an impressive camera

With the P40 Pro, Huawei has once again released an excellent camera smartphone and most likely even... Trumpled to death? In our review, the Huawei P40 Pro presents itself as a great piece of hardware not least due to the fact that it is equipped with the best smartphone camera out there. We expected nothing less. Unfortunately, the ban from Google services makes a clear recommendation difficult. Read on to find out which users should still consider the Huawei phone and what drawbacks need to be taken into account.
Pros:
  • spectacular camera setup
  • color-accurate 90-Hz OLED display
  • fast Wi-Fi 6 and 5G
  • expandable storage
  • supports hybrid SIM and eSIM
  • very good call quality
  • USB 3.1 with HDMI/dP
  • IP68-certified
Cons:
  • no DRM certification
  • no aptX or aptX HD
  • display could have offered more brightness reserves
  • no Google services
  • weak speakers
  • no barometer

Huawei P40 Pro review

A superb follow-up to one of 2019's best smartphones. The Huawei P40 Pro improves in every area, offering top-tier performance and networking, superb battery life and fast charging, a stupendous camera setup on both the front and back, plus that eye-catching 90Hz 'Overflow' display. Despite how capable this phone is, however, the absence of Google Mobile Services makes this a poor recommendation for anyone other than die-hard Huawei fans and the tech-savvy. Those just looking for a great flagship phone, will probably prefer the ease of hopping onto one of the new Galaxy S20 series or Oppo's Find X2 Pro.
